Full description
Description:
The role is responsible for leading and managing mechanical engineering activities supporting pharmaceutical manufacturing operations. The role ensures design, installation, operation, maintenance, and optimization of mechanical systems and utilities in compliance with quality, safety, regulatory, cost, and performance standards. It involves interpreting engineering drawings, plans, and specifications, overseeing execution, and ensuring validated and audit-ready systems. The role supports resource planning, team guidance, vendor coordination, and continuous improvement initiatives. It contributes to reliable production operations, timely project execution, and engineering governance, while ensuring adherence to established engineering standards, SOPs, and regulatory requirements.
Essential Functions:
- Manage multiple greenfield and brownfield engineering projects covering manufacturing equipment, utilities, automation, facility modifications and capacity-expansion initiatives.
- Lead project initiation, scope definition, URS preparation, capital approval, project planning, risk assessment and governance.
- Participate in conceptual, basic and detailed engineering with user functions, CFTs, engineering consultants and PMC.
- Coordinate preparation and review of design-basis documents, layouts, P&IDs, utility requirements, equipment specifications and detailed engineering deliverables.
- Lead vendor technical discussions, technical bid evaluation, vendor recommendation, drawing review and execution coordination.
- Develop and monitor project schedules, procurement plans, delivery schedules, installation plans, commissioning plans and qualification milestones.
- Conduct regular progress reviews, maintain project dashboards and provide structured updates to site and corporate leadership.
- Coordinate site readiness, equipment installation, utility integration, automation, commissioning, qualification and formal handover.
- Monitor project scope, cost, schedule, risks, changes, safety, quality and documentation throughout the lifecycle.
- Ensure compliance with applicable GMP, EHS, validation, company engineering and statutory requirements.
- Facilitate timely resolution of cross-functional and vendor-related issues and implement recovery plans for schedule deviations.
- Complete project closure through punch-point resolution, as-built documentation, training, spares, warranty and lessons-learned review.
